core: add a suspend cause flags field
Diffstat (limited to 'src/pulsecore/core.h')
-rw-r--r-- | src/pulsecore/core.h | 10 |
1 files changed, 10 insertions, 0 deletions
diff --git a/src/pulsecore/core.h b/src/pulsecore/core.h index c6794445..09a880c4 100644 --- a/src/pulsecore/core.h +++ b/src/pulsecore/core.h @@ -27,6 +27,16 @@ typedef struct pa_core pa_core; +/* This is a bitmask that encodes the cause why a sink/source is + * suspended. */ +typedef enum pa_suspend_cause { + PA_SUSPEND_USER = 1, /* Exposed to the user via some protocol */ + PA_SUSPEND_APPLICATION = 2, /* Used by the device reservation logic */ + PA_SUSPEND_IDLE = 4, /* Used by module-suspend-on-idle */ + PA_SUSPEND_SESSION = 8, /* Used by module-hal for mark inactive sessions */ + PA_SUSPEND_ALL = 0xFFFF /* Magic cause that can be used to resume forcibly */ +} pa_suspend_cause_t; + #include <pulsecore/idxset.h> #include <pulsecore/hashmap.h> #include <pulsecore/memblock.h> |
